Scarecrow
Иннеар ORPG
offline
Опыт:
3,289Активность: |
Локальные переменные
Разъясните кто нибудь, какие именно ЛП надо обнулять, и в каких случаях? А то по форуму много сбивчивой информации, хотелось бы цельного и четкого комментария... |
16.07.2010, 20:06 | #1
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Nekit1234007
offline
Опыт:
11,916Активность: |
Не обнулям интегер, реал, стринг, булин, плеер. |
16.07.2010, 20:14 | #2
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
AlexKARASb
Learning cpp
offline
Опыт:
22,103Активность: |
обнулению подлежат хендлы: unit, effect итд стринг, числа итд не нуждаются в обнулении: string,player,integer,real etc.. извеняюсь, не видел что написали уже |
16.07.2010, 20:16 | #3
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
JassMan
свободен
offline
Опыт:
4,193Активность: |
вроде еще boolexpr не надо . . . |
16.07.2010, 22:22 | #4
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
bee
vjass.optimizer
offline
Опыт:
16,615Активность: |
JassMan, омг.
|
16.07.2010, 23:12 | #5
+0/−1
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
ScorpioT1000
Работаем
offline
Опыт: отключен
|
|
17.07.2010, 09:20 | #6
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
silumin
offline
Опыт:
11,153Активность: |
ScorpioT1002, читал статью по ссылке давно и бегло. Сейчас ещё раз перечитал и у меня возник вопрос. Получается, что код:
Код:
Или не является т.к. boolexpr задаётся в параметрах функции пика? |
17.07.2010, 11:47 | #7
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
Vampirrr
O_o
offline
Опыт:
19,286Активность: |
silumin, нет, утечным не является |
17.07.2010, 17:45 | #8
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|
ScorpioT1000
Работаем
offline
Опыт: отключен
|
кондишен создается в стеке, а хендлы в стеке норм трутся, так же как и
function A takes unit u
ScorpioT1002 добавил: и да, даже если твой энум вызовется много раз, кондишен не будет создаваться много раз, т.к. указана одна и та же функция, она не будет дублироваться Отредактировано ScorpioT1002, 19.07.2010 в 04:24. |
17.07.2010, 23:43 | #9
+0/−0
Профиль |
Приват |
Поиск |
Цитата |
IP: Записан
|